GSDs, like any large breed dog, are susceptible to health issues. However when they exercise regularly and eat eating a balanced diet, these dogs are generally healthy. Prevention measures like getting your GSDs vaccinated and microchipped can help keep them healthy. Some of the most frequent GSD health concerns include elbow and hip dysplasia, pannus (superficial keratitis) and eye issues like cataracts.

If you're considering buying a German Shepherd, it's important to do your homework. Find a breeder that has good breeding practices and who can provide an medical background of both parents. This will help you understand any genetic or hereditary issues that could be a concern to the breed. Some breeders will also provide guarantees, warranties, and contracts with specific stipulations that protect both the buyer and the seller.

When examining puppies, make sure they weigh in the right amount and have a clean coat free of mats or odors. The eyes and ears should be clear and clean. A GSD should also have a healthy appetite and energy level. Avoid puppies with diarrhea, vomiting or a eruption of rashes.

Training

German Shepherds are intelligent and obedient dogs that respond well to training. They make excellent pets for all ages. They are also utilized by law enforcement agencies and the military for their special herding instincts and protection qualities.

You must, however, be prepared to spend a lot time and energy training your dog. You must also ensure that there is enough space for the German Shepherd to play and run. They should be happy and healthy by getting enough exercise. If you don't have the space or time to allow your dog to get the exercise they need, you should consider getting another breed of dog or arranging for a dog-walker to come and visit them at least once a day.

When you train your German Shepherd, be sure to use consistent verbal and physical cues. This will allow your dog to learn commands quickly and prevent confusion. It is also essential to train your dog for a brief period of time every day. In this way, they'll have a chance to learn new skills and not get bored during training sessions.

Socialize your dog as soon as you can. This will teach them that strangers are not to be feared. This is particularly important for GSD puppies as they are known to be sensitive and their socialization period is often shorter than other breeds of dogs. It is recommended to begin by initiating your German Shepherd to other people and animals in small, controlled environments when they are 8 weeks old.

It is also important to take your German Shepherd on car rides at an early age to show them that the car is a safe place for them to be. This will help them avoid developing anxiety about cars later in life. You should also practice alone training to prevent separation anxiety in your German Shepherd when they get older. It can take time to complete this process, but the results will be worth it. If you have the right circumstances the German shepherd can be among your most loyal and obedient dogs.
